#ea4186 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ea4186 is composed of 91.8% red, 25.5%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.2% magenta, 42.7%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 335.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 58.6%. #ea4186 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82ff with #d5000d.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

Shades and Tints of #ea4186

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040002 is the darkest color, while #fef2f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ea4186

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999295 is the less saturated color, while #fa3183 is the most saturated one.
